BitFuFu Reports March 2026 Bitcoin Production and Operational Performance
BitFuFu March 2026 Bitcoin Production and Operational Updates

BitFuFu Inc., a globally recognized leader in Bitcoin mining and innovative mining services, has released its unaudited production and operational data for March 2026. The company, listed on NASDAQ under the ticker FUFU, disclosed key metrics that highlight its performance and strategic adjustments in the volatile cryptocurrency market.

March 2026 Operational Highlights

As of March 31, 2026, BitFuFu managed a total hashrate of 25.9 exahashes per second (EH/s), representing a significant year-over-year increase of 25.7%. This figure remained largely stable compared to the previous month. The company produced 214 Bitcoin during March, comprising 171 BTC from cloud mining operations and 43 BTC from self-mining activities. This production level reflects a slight decrease from February 2026, when 227 BTC were generated.

Bitcoin Holdings and Strategic Sales

BitFuFu reported holding 1,794 Bitcoin as of the end of March, a reduction of 36 BTC from the 1,830 BTC held at the close of February. The company strategically sold 80 BTC in March as part of its treasury management approach, aiming to balance liquidity with long-term accumulation goals. Leo Lu, Chairman and CEO of BitFuFu, emphasized that this move aligns with the company's objective to responsibly manage its Bitcoin balance sheet while continuing to build holdings over time.

Efficiency and Infrastructure Metrics

The average fleet efficiency for BitFuFu in March 2026 was recorded at 17.7 joules per terahash (J/TH), indicating a marginal increase from 17.5 J/TH in February. This metric underscores the company's focus on optimizing energy consumption in mining operations. Total power capacity under management stood at 457 megawatts (MW), showing a year-over-year decrease of 4.4% but remaining consistent with recent months.

Hashrate Breakdown and Portfolio Optimization

Of the total hashrate, 3.3 EH/s was attributed to self-owned mining equipment, down from 3.6 EH/s in February. This decline resulted from the disposal of older-generation machines, part of BitFuFu's strategy to refresh its fleet with more energy-efficient technology. The remaining 22.6 EH/s came from third-party suppliers and hosting customers, with minimal month-to-month fluctuations deemed normal within operational variability.

Market Dynamics and Cloud Mining Opportunities

Leo Lu commented on the broader market context, noting heightened volatility in network difficulty since the start of 2026. This volatility, driven by miners curtailing operations when Bitcoin prices fall below breakeven levels, creates potential advantages for cloud mining customers. According to Lu, such conditions may allow customers to accumulate Bitcoin at lower effective costs during price dips and benefit from increased output when difficulty declines. BitFuFu positions its cloud mining platform as a versatile tool for both retail and institutional clients navigating these shifting market landscapes.
